About the author:

On March 20, 2013, I, Will Bevis, decided to embrace what I am: a writer of sometimes controversial prose and short stories, articles, and memoirs. I no longer apologize for not writing or wanting to write long novels. I am what I am, and I do what I do, and I accept myself and what I do.

A couple of years ago, I was one of the first--if not the very first--to publish single short stories on Amazon.com, when everybody else was sure only novels would sell. They were wrong. Now I look around and see many others selling short stories, including one novelist who laughed at what I was doing. Yes, some of the almighty ones are selling their single short stories online now, too.

Starting today, with "Son of Sam Shuffle," I will again be one of the first--if not the first--to do something unusual, and that is to publish single short pieces of prose on Amazon.com as well.

There really shouldn't be any problem.

If you don't like to read short prose from a writer, simply don't buy it. I try to tell people clearly in the story description that I write short stories, and I haven't had a problem in a long time with people complaining.
